Pro Maintenance Tips
Keep your inverter humming like new:
- Clean vents monthly (dust reduces efficiency by up to 15%)
- Maintain 2-inch clearance around the unit
- Avoid exceeding 80% capacity for extended use

FAQ: Your Questions Answered
Can I run a refrigerator on a 12V inverter?
Yes, but you''ll need at least a 1500W pure sine wave model and proper battery capacity.
How long do these inverters typically last?
Quality units last 5-8 years with proper maintenance and moderate usage.
Expert Tip: Always check surge capacity ratings – many appliances need 2-3x their running wattage during startup!
